Output 5688814bab10b11c5412c27ec88d234685ebc5fd1729d1a1181af5bf5bb3a665:0

value
6638610
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f68774a73c7f24f5d589b24e136686d86fa039 OP_EQUALVERIFY OP_CHECKSIG
address
1DrLw11EgHWJ76gWXWEkA1q4WyBKDmbXJk
transaction
5688814bab10b11c5412c27ec88d234685ebc5fd1729d1a1181af5bf5bb3a665
spent
true